The elusive goal carbon dioxide target after cardiac arrest.
-
Partial pressure of arterial carbon dioxide (PaCO2) is a regulator of cerebral blood flow after brain injury. We sought to test the association between PaCO2 after resuscitation from cardiac arrest and neurological outcome. ⋯ PaCO2 has a "U" shaped association with neurological outcome, with mild to moderate hypercapnia having the highest probability of good neurological outcome.

Optimal training frequency for acquisition and retention of high-quality CPR skills: A randomized trial.
Spaced training programs employ short, frequent CPR training sessions to improve provider skills. The optimum training frequency for CPR skill acquisition and retention has not been determined. We aimed to determine the training interval associated with the highest quality CPR performance at one year. ⋯ Short-duration, distributed CPR training on a manikin with real-time visual feedback is effective in improving CPR performance, with monthly training more effective than training every 3, 6, or 12 months.

North American validation of the Bokutoh criteria for withholding professional resuscitation in non-traumatic out-of-hospital cardiac arrest.
Certain subgroups of patients with out-of-hospital cardiac arrest (OHCA) may not benefit from treatment. Early identification of this cohort in the prehospital (EMS) setting prior to any resuscitative efforts would prevent futile medical therapy and more appropriately allocate EMS and hospital resources. We sought to validate a clinical criteria from Bokutoh, Japan that identified a subgroup of OHCAs for whom withholding resuscitation may be appropriate. ⋯ In this validation of the Bokutoh criteria in a large North American cohort of OHCA patients, 0.51% meeting criteria had favourable neurological outcomes. This may rapidly and reliably identify the one-fifth of OHCA who are very unlikely to benefit from resuscitation.
